About Udri Village

Udri is a small village in Sagar tehsil, in the district of Shimoga, Karnataka. The Census of India 2011 recorded a population of 162, made up of 83 males and 79 females. That works out to a sex ratio of about 952 females per 1000 males. The village covers 228.59 hectares hectares. Its pincode is 577401, shared with the other villages in the same post office area.

Getting to Udri

The census records public bus service for Udri as Available within village. Private bus service is recorded as Available within <5 km distance. For rail, the census notes the nearest railway station as Available within 10+ km distance. These entries describe what was recorded in 2011 and services may have changed since.
